About this property
Step in to this charming 3 bedrooms home with dedicated OFFICE. Office could easily double as a 4th bedroom with access to shared bathroom. Formal dining at front could also serve as an office is 4th bedroom is desired. This open flow floorplan is great for family gatherings and POOL parties for all your friends. the private master suite is located on opposite side of home from secondary bedrooms and office with great view overlooking the large backyard and pool. This home offers a wall of windows overlooking the pool from the inside living space. The pool offers a generous patio area perfect for entertaining outdoors or enjoying a family dinner. Plus, lots of grass space to run and play. Situated in the heart of Stonebridge Ranch with access to all kinds of dining and shopping and the award winning McKinney ISD. Great curb appeal and convenient front entry on this north facing home. Stonebridge Community amenities are unmatched in their excellence.

Learn About the Market: Opportunity in Texas




Explore
Texas
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
